Cleaning products supplier services in London, Mpumalanga, South Africa
Within the town of London in the Mpumalanga province, cleaning products suppliers provide essential goods and related services to a diverse range of customers. From small businesses and schools to hospitality venues and healthcare facilities, these suppliers are expected to offer a reliable mix of chemical products, equipment and practical support to keep premises hygienic and compliant. The focus tends to be on a balance between cost effectiveness, safety, and environmental responsibility, with attention paid to local procurement preferences and market demand.
Typical offerings encompass a broad spectrum of products and services. Core inventories include general purpose cleaners, degreasers, bathroom and sanitising products, floor care solutions, dishwashing liquids, glass and surface cleaners, and specialised items such as disinfectants and sanitisers. In many cases, suppliers also stock disposable PPE, cleaning cloths, mop systems, and consumables to support day-to-day operations. For facilities seeking a cohesive approach, there is often the option to source compatible detergents and sanitisers that work together to maintain efficiency and reduce stockholding complexity.
Another common element is the provision of bulk purchasing and delivery services. Customers typically place orders by phone, email, or through a regional sales contact, and expect timely delivery to a specified location. Stock availability, minimum order quantities, and lead times are practical considerations, particularly for busy establishments or institutions with strict cleaning schedules. Some suppliers may offer flexible credit terms or invoicing arrangements, subject to satisfactory business references and order history.
Technical and compliance support forms a meaningful part of the service mix. Suppliers may provide safety data sheets (SDS), guidance on safe handling and storage, and basic product usage information. Staff from supplier organisations can offer advice on choosing products that suit particular surfaces, soil levels, and environmental or health-and-safety requirements. Where new cleaning programmes are introduced, training or demonstrations for dispensing, dilution, and correct application can help ensure effectiveness while minimising waste and risk.
Environmental and regulatory considerations influence service delivery. Many customers seek eco-friendly or greener cleaning options, including biodegradable formulations, reduced packaging, and concentrates designed to lower plastic use. Local customers expect compliance with South African regulations on chemical handling, waste management, and occupational health and safety standards. Suppliers may highlight sustainable product lines or recycling options without overstating capabilities, focusing on transparent product information rather than claims that cannot be substantiated in the marketplace.
Practical workflows commonly observed include the following. First, a needs assessment or consultation helps identify the range of products required, current stock levels, and any upcoming maintenance programmes. Second, a quotation or order is prepared, often with suggested substitutions to match budget or sustainability goals. Third, products are delivered on a scheduled basis, with options for on-site stock management or regular replenishment cycles. Fourth, customers receive ongoing support such as usage tips, seasonal promotions, and updates about new products or safer alternatives as regulations evolve.
When engaging with a cleaning products supplier in London, Mpumalanga, clients should consider factors such as delivery reliability, product availability for both routine and bulk orders, and the clarity of product information. Practical questions include whether the supplier can accommodate specific cleaning regimes, offer guidance on dilution rates, and provide timely after-sales assistance. Overall, the relationship tends to hinge on dependable stock, straightforward pricing, practical logistical arrangements, and clear communication about product characteristics and safety compliance.
